Just over a year ago, U.S. Senator Saxby Chambliss (R - Georgia) cast two votes that are now being spotlighted in a new ad by the Democratic Senatorial Campaign Committee (DSCC) now airing on Georgia television.



The votes cast by Chambliss were against re-authorizing the State Children's Health Insurance Program (S-CHIP), the parent program for Georgia's popular PeachCare for Kids health insurance plan [Source: Senate Roll Call Vote #403; and #307].

PeachCare for Kids is a comprehensive health care program for uninsured children living in Georgia. The health benefits include primary, preventive, specialist, dental care and vision care.

Chambliss defended his votes against S-CHIP during a stop in Dalton, Georgia last November saying that he supported the program ten years ago when it was first put in place.

"I still support it," Chambliss said. [Source: Chattanooga Times-Free Press, "Chambliss makes stop in Dalton", November 5, 2007]
